Once upon a time, in a cozy little house nestled beside a babbling brook, lived three fluffy kittens: Pip, Squeak, and Mew. Pip was a playful tabby, Squeak a mischievous calico, and Mew a sweet, sleepy Siamese.
One evening, as the sun dipped below the horizon, Mama Cat brought out a basket overflowing with soft, fluffy toys. There were fuzzy mice, bouncy balls, and even a tiny knitted bird! Pip, Squeak, and Mew’s eyes widened with excitement.
Pip, being the eldest, immediately grabbed the biggest fuzzy mouse. Squeak snatched the bouncy ball, bouncing it so high it almost hit the ceiling. Mew, quiet as always, carefully chose a small, soft yarn ball.
But soon, trouble began. Pip wanted the bouncy ball too, and he tried to take it from Squeak. Squeak, feeling grumpy, hissed and refused to share. Mew, seeing their squabble, quietly put down her yarn ball and looked sad.
Mama Cat gently nudged them with her nose. "My dear kittens," she purred, "sharing is caring. When we share, everyone has fun!" She showed them how they could all play together with the toys, taking turns and helping each other.
Pip, Squeak, and Mew looked at each other. They realized that Mama Cat was right! They started to play together, sharing their toys and even making up new games. Pip helped Squeak catch the bouncy ball, and Squeak gently helped Mew roll her yarn ball.
After a while, feeling sleepy and happy from their playtime, the three kittens snuggled together in their cozy bed. Mama Cat settled down beside them, purring softly. "Sharing makes bedtime even more special," she whispered.
Pip, Squeak, and Mew closed their eyes, feeling content and loved. They had learned that sharing made playtime more fun, and it even made bedtime sweeter. They all drifted off to sleep, dreaming of fluffy mice, bouncy balls, and the warmth of their loving family.
And as you close your eyes tonight, remember the three kittens and their lesson about sharing and caring. Sweet dreams!
